Hello everyone call me Kent! I grew up owning 2 bearded dragons and I just adored them. However they passed they away several years ago due to getting sick and we couldn't really afford a vet visit at the time. RIP Scooby and Scrapy. Moving on about a month ago I decided I really want a new reptilian friend, and after some research I decided a Blue Tongue Skink was the companion for me! So I got a cage all set up and ready to go. And I have know been a proud owner of an Eastern BTS named Elanor for over a week, she is about 6-8months old btw. We had a rough first 2-3 days with her not eating and starting up shedding right when she got to her new home. But she is now done shedding, regularly eating and drinking, and basking, as far as I know. See the thing is iv never actually seen her since she first crawled into one of her hides on the day I got her. I expected this to to be normal for the first several days. I know she is out while I'm gone at work cause the food is gone and she has left me a little surprise in her cage. I get home around 5pm and she is all ready in one of her hides or completely burred in substrate somewhere. So I figured I would see her on the weekend and I could try bonding with her. But she just doesn't want to come out of hiding when people are around. I have heard story's of some peoples BTS becoming super independent and not letting their owners handle them from them not getting enough human interaction. I really want to form a bond with my BTS! What should I do? Is it ok to take her out of her hide/ unburry her and handle her. So she will get used to me. Or should I just keep waiting for her to come out of hiding while I am around.

You sir, have a Halmahera Indonesian.
They very much tend to be more timid and shy, and may require some time.
I know you are anxious about seeing your skink, making sure she's OK, and wanting to start interacting with her. I would honestly give it another week or two, just to let her stress levels come down nice and good after all she's been through. After another week or two of just changing her water and food, if you ever see her out, just calmly but assuredly pick her up. Check the thread in FAQ how to securely do it, then sit down on the floor, or a near-by couch, and put her on your lap, see what happens.

Thank you very much of the help! I didn't even know that was a type of BTS. besides being a bit more shy is there anything else I should know about her specific breed?
Re: Hello Im New Here! And Im allready haveing some troubles
Posted: Sat Oct 24, 2015 2:56 pm
by Susann
Yes. You need to keep humidity very high, in the 80% range, and/or give her a humid hide.
Other than that, you should be good to go.
